Hayward TurboCell S3 Salt Cell, 40,000 Gallons, 15' Cord | TCELLS340

The Hayward TurboCell S3 Salt Cell (TCELLS340) is a replacement salt chlorination cell designed for in-ground saltwater pools up to 40,000 gallons. This cell automatically converts dissolved salt into chlorine, providing consistent sanitization while reducing the need for manual chlorine additions. It includes a 15-foot power cord for flexible installation and reliable electrical connection.

What This Part Is For

This salt cell is used with Hayward salt chlorination systems that support TurboCell S3 technology. It replaces a worn or depleted cell to restore proper chlorine generation and maintain stable sanitizer levels in saltwater pools.

Installation Notes

  • Power down the salt chlorination system before replacing the cell
  • Install the cell in the return line according to system flow direction
  • Ensure all unions and electrical connections are secure before operation
  • Verify proper salt level and flow once the system is restarted

Maintenance Tips

  • Inspect the cell regularly for calcium scale buildup
  • Clean the cell only when buildup is visible, following recommended procedures
  • Maintain proper salt and water chemistry to extend cell life
  • Replace the cell when chlorine output can no longer be maintained
